Answer:

Arc BC = 117°

Step-by-step explanation:

Angle D is an inscribed angle that intercepts arc ABC. According to the Inscribed angle theorem of a circle, m<D = ½ of arc ABC.

Thus,

104° = ½(AB + BC)

104° = ½(91° + BC)

Multiply both sides by 2

104*2 = 91 + BC

208 = 91 + BC

Subtract both sides by 91

208 - 91 = BC

117 = BC

Arc BC = 117°
